I’ve Got a Clush on Entourage

I finally managed to get caught up on Entourage the other day. The most recent episode was hysterical as per usual, but it also got me thinking of all the entrepreneurial undertones of the show. For example, the boys recently struck out on their own to produce the high-risk independent film, Medellin. Eric is now his own agent, balancing friendships, learning to trust his gut, and trying to sell clients (Anna Faris). Even Ari has his own firm.

I think it’s great that an exceedingly popular television show is really, at its core, about best friends making their own way in business and in life.

I also loved Johnny Drama’s new word: Client + Crush = “Clush.” Along the same lines, here is a new UGC slang dictionary.
